Ole H. Hald Panagiotis Stinis

The “t-model” for dimensional reduction is applied to the estimation of the rate of decay of solutions of the Burgers equation and of the Euler equations in two and three space dimensions. The model was first derived in a statistical mechanics context, but here we analyze it purely as a numerical tool and prove its convergence. Weijiu Liu

In this paper, we consider the Burgers’ equation with a time delay. By using the Liapunov function method, we show that the delayed Burgers’ equation is exponentially stable if the delay parameter is sufficiently small.
